What You'll Do
- Electrical Troubleshooting: Perform limited electrical troubleshooting, repair, and installation of motor controls, fuses, circuit breakers, and similar components.
- Machinery Repair: Troubleshoot, repair, and install complex machinery using air, hydraulics, motors, bearings, and related systems.
- Fabrication: Fabricate production equipment, fixtures, support frames, benches, and shelving; welding and fabrication skills preferred.
- Preventative Maintenance: Schedule and perform detailed preventative maintenance on a variety of equipment, including SMT placement machines, wave solders, and selective solder systems, following manufacturer-recommended procedures.
- Plumbing: Perform limited repair and installation of pipes and plumbing carrying gas, water, vacuum, air, or miscellaneous hydraulic oils.
- Electrical Wiring: Perform limited repair and installation of low-voltage electrical wiring in the facility, including computer and phone lines.
- Facilities Upkeep: Repair and improve facility buildings, grounds, and equipment.
- Equipment Refurbishment: Refurbish production equipment through detailed cleaning, painting, replacing worn parts, and calibration to bring machines to like-new condition.
What You'll Need to Succeed
- A High School Diploma/GED Equivalent
- A Two-year industrial maintenance degree or technical certificate, or 3-5 years of relevant experience
- Preferred Qualifications: High voltage electrical knowledge, Forklift or scissor lift experience, Leadership training
